POSITION OVERVIEW

The Cascade PBS's mission is to inform and inspire our community to make the world a better place.

Our vision is to be the most essential and relevant media organization in the region.

The major gift officer will identify, cultivate, solicit and steward current and prospective major donors and secure gifts at the $2,500+ level to reach more people, build a strong organization, and to be the most essential and relevant media organization in the region, while demonstrating Cascade PBS's values of integrity, community, innovation and diversity.

KEY RESPONSIBILITIES / DUTIES

  • Manage the identification, cultivation, solicitation, and stewardship of donors by developing relationships with major donors ($2,500+) focusing on individuals with potential of $25,000 or more.
  • Develop and implement a cultivation and solicitation strategy for each assigned current and prospective major donor.
  • Prepare solicitation strategies, meeting briefings, written proposals, and impact reports for use during donor cultivation, solicitation, and stewardship activities.
  • Cultivate and solicit donors through high-touch personal communications and exceptional customer service.
  • Achieve 6-8 face-to-face visits with donors each month (unless donor indicates otherwise) that move the donor to towards a major gift commitment.
  • Record and track all activity using Cascade PBS' prospect management and tracking system. Prepare, review, and edit written proposals, agreements, gift illustrations, and other materials needed to secure and steward major gifts.
  • Develop appropriate stewardship activities for each donor within the context of the overall stewardship plan.
  • Create monthly reports as required or requested that reflect caseload activity.
  • Attend development planning meetings and development department meetings to develop deep understanding of organizational programs, priorities, and goals to accurately present them to donors.
  • Clearly communicate Cascade PBS' mission to donors.
  • Work with events team, production team, and journalists to plan donor stewardship and cultivation initiatives.
  • Develop and maintain relationships with business and community leaders as well as other development officers within the community.
  • Collaborate with other team members to foster a positive and productive culture and contribute toward the overall growth of Cascade PBS.
  • Other duties, responsibilities and activities may change or be assigned at any time with or without notice

REQUIRED SKILLS / ABILITIES

  • Must excel in working with high net-worth individuals, families, and businesses and have the ability to compel investment in the Cascade PBS mission.
  • Thorough working knowledge of MS Office (Word, Excel, and Outlook) required.
  • Strong research skills, fundraising database and membership management experience required.
  • Extensive local and regional travel throughout Washington required.
  • EDUCATION AND EXPERIENCE

  • Bachelor's degree or equivalent relevant experience required.
  • Five years' experience fundraising for non-profit organizations required.
  • Demonstrated successful experience and effectiveness in prospect identification, relationship building, solicitation, and Board interaction required.
  • ROI CRM experience preferred
